What Is A2 Ghee?

A2 Ghee is crafted from the milk of native cows such as Gir or Sahiwal. Unlike ghee made from A1 milk or mixed cow milk, it contains only A2 protein, which supports better digestion and provides natural energy.

Traditionally, A2 Ghee is made using the Bilona method, where milk is turned into curd, churned into butter, and slowly heated to obtain pure ghee. This method preserves essential nutrients, aroma, and flavor, ensuring maximum health benefits.

Tips for Buying Authentic A2 Ghee

When you decide to Buy A2 Ghee, consider the following factors to ensure quality and purity:

  1. Check the Source: Verify the cow breed and whether milk is from indigenous cows.

  2. Preparation Method: Look for traditional Bilona or hand-churned ghee for authenticity.

  3. Ingredients: Ensure there are no additives, preservatives, or artificial flavors.

  4. Packaging: Airtight containers maintain freshness and prevent contamination.

  5. Reputation of Seller: Choose trusted brands or verified sellers with transparent sourcing.

These tips help you avoid adulterated products and enjoy the full benefits of genuine A2 Ghee.


How to Use A2 Ghee Daily

A2 Ghee is versatile and can be used in multiple ways:

  • Cooking, frying, or roasting due to its high smoke point

  • Adding to rice, dal, roti, or parathas for enhanced flavor

  • Consuming a small spoon on an empty stomach for digestion and detox

  • Mixing with warm milk or herbal drinks for immunity support

  • Topical application for healthy skin and hair

Its adaptability makes it easy to include in modern and traditional diets alike.
